Tip 1: Know Your Audience

Before diving into video production, it’s crucial to understand your target audience inside and out. Research and analyze their demographics, interests, and behaviors to create content that speaks directly to them.

Knowing your audience is not just about having a general idea of who they are. It’s about diving deeply into their world and understanding what makes them tick. This means conducting thorough market research, analyzing data, and even conducting surveys or interviews to gather insights.

By understanding your audience on a deeper level, you can create content that resonates with them on a personal level. You’ll know exactly what topics they’re interested in, what challenges they’re facing, and what kind of content they find valuable.

 

Identifying Your Target Demographic

Start by defining your target demographic. Who are they? What are their preferences and pain points? By answering these questions, you can tailor your video to resonate with your specific audience and increase the chances of engaging them.

For example, if your target audience is young professionals in the tech industry, you may want to create videos that speak to their specific challenges and interests. You might focus on topics like career development, work-life balance, or the latest tech trends.

On the other hand, if your target audience is stay-at-home parents, your videos might revolve around parenting tips, family-friendly recipes, or home organization hacks.

Understanding your audience on a deep level allows you to connect and curate content that will hold their attention.

Understanding Audience Preferences

Every audience has unique preferences when it comes to consuming video content. Some may prefer shorter, snackable videos, while others may enjoy longer, more in-depth content. Understanding these preferences allows you to optimize the length, format, and style of your videos to capture and retain viewers’ attention.

One way to gather insights into audience preferences is by analyzing the performance of your existing videos. Look at metrics like view duration, engagement rate, and comments to see what type of content resonates the most with your audience.

Additionally, you can also conduct surveys or polls to directly ask your audience about their preferences. This can give you valuable feedback and help you tailor your video content to meet their needs.

Remember, knowing your audience is an ongoing process. As trends change and new technologies emerge, it’s important to stay updated and continue gathering insights to ensure your videos remain relevant and engaging.

Tip 3: Prioritize High-Quality Visuals and Sound

Great visuals and crisp sound are vital elements in creating an engaging video production experience. They enhance the overall viewing experience and convey your brand’s professionalism and attention to detail.

 

The Importance of Visual Aesthetics in Video Production

In the visually driven world of social media, aesthetics play a crucial role in capturing attention. Use visually appealing graphics, colors, and imagery that align with your brand’s identity. Consistent aesthetics will create a visually cohesive experience across your video content.

When it comes to visual aesthetics, it’s important to consider factors such as composition, lighting, and framing. These elements can greatly impact the overall look and feel of your video. Pay attention to the placement of objects within the frame, the use of natural or artificial lighting to create a desired mood, and the framing of your shots to draw the viewer’s attention to key elements.

Additionally, the use of visual effects can add a touch of creativity and uniqueness to your video. Whether it’s subtle transitions between scenes or eye-catching animations, incorporating visual effects can elevate the production value and make your video more visually appealing.

 

Ensuring Clear and Crisp Audio

Don’t underestimate the power of high-quality audio. Poor audio can ruin the viewer’s experience and make your video seem unprofessional. Invest in good audio equipment and ensure that your dialogue, voiceovers, and background sounds are clear and easily understandable.

When recording audio, consider the environment in which you are capturing sound. Background noise can be distracting and diminish the overall quality of your video. Choose a quiet location or use soundproofing techniques to minimize unwanted noise.

Furthermore, pay attention to the levels and balance of your audio. Ensure that the volume of dialogue and voiceovers is consistent throughout the video, and that background music or sound effects do not overpower the main audio elements. A well-balanced audio mix will enhance the viewer’s experience and make your video more enjoyable to watch.

In post-production, take the time to edit and clean up your audio. Remove any unwanted noise, adjust levels, and apply equalization or other audio effects to enhance clarity. By putting effort into the audio quality of your video, you demonstrate a commitment to delivering a professional and engaging experience to your audience.

High-quality production conveys your brand’s professionalism and reduces barriers to understanding your message.
